Build a reliable content experience

Use this scene to evaluate long-form readability, muted supporting text, links, borders, callouts, and code-like surfaces.

Updated today · 8 min read · Version 2.1

Color roles should stay comfortable across dense paragraphs. A strong inline link should read as interactive without overpowering the surrounding copy.

Surfaces and borders need enough separation to frame reference material while keeping attention on the article text hierarchy.
